Water-Based Therapy Advantages for for Musculoskeletal Issues

Aquatic therapy is a unique form of rehabilitation that takes place in a pool. It is particularly beneficial for individuals with muscle and joint issues, which affect the muscles, skeletal system, and articulations. The floating effect of water lessens the impact on the body, allowing patients to perform exercises with reduced discomfort and strain. This environment helps to stabilize the body, making it easier to navigate and engage in physical activity. As a result, aquatic therapy can enhance muscle power, flexibility, and overall movement ability for those dealing from conditions such as arthritis, back pain, and rehabilitation after surgery.



One of the main benefits of aquatic therapy is the ability to execute exercises that may be difficult or impossible on land. The drag of water provides a distinct opportunity for muscle building without the risk of injury associated with traditional weightlifting. Patients can participate in a variety of exercises, such as walking, stretching, and strength workouts, all while gaining from the discover this soothing properties of warm water. This can lead to enhanced muscle strength and stamina, which are crucial for daily activities and overall well-being. Additionally, the heat of the water can help to relax muscles and alleviate stiffness, further improving the therapeutic experience.



Moreover, aquatic therapy promotes a sense of well-being and relaxation, which is crucial for individuals dealing with chronic pain or recovery from injury. The tranquil environment of water can help lower stress and tension, making therapy sessions more pleasant. Patients often share feeling more inspired to webpage take part in their rehabilitation when they are in a nurturing and welcoming environment. Overall, aquatic therapy offers a holistic approach to treating musculoskeletal conditions, merging physical benefits with psychological well-being, making it an valuable option for many individuals looking for relief and recovery.
